Abstract

748,943. Exhaust silencers. MCFARLANE HARRISON, Ltd. June 25 1954 [March 25, 1953]. No. 8181/53. Class 7(2) In a silencer having its interior subdivided by one or more transverse baffles E<SP>1</SP>, E<SP>2</SP> and E<SP>3</SP>, the or each baffle, as well as the barrel A and ends C<SP>1</SP>, C<SP>2</SP> of the silencer, comprise two thicknesses of sheet metal with an interposed layer L of material which has a permanent sounddeadening effect. The sound-deadening material may comprise fine sand, flue dust, i.e. a by-product of a shot blasting process, wire wool, horsehair or honeycomb cardboard. As shown, baffles comprising two identical metal discs 10 marginally radiused at 11 and secured together by rings 12 divide the interior of a barrel A into expansion chambers of mutually differing volumes, those chambers communicating with each other by way of openings in the baffles or open-ended perforated tubes I, or both. The tubes I, which may have longitudinal ribs, are spaced angularly around a main opening F<SP>1</SP> in the baffle E<SP>1</SP>. A perforated outlet tube J fixed in an opening F" in the baffle E<SP>3</SP> and which may be provided with longitudinal ribs extends into an outlet tube K associated with the wall C<SP>2</SP>. The baffles have angularly spaced, pressed-in recesses 16, preferably on the same pitch circle as the openings H<SP>1</SP>, H<SP>2</SP> and H<SP>3</SP> for the tubes I, producing at the inner sides of the discs 10 complementary bosses 17 facing one another in closelyspaced relation, and similar formations may be provided on the inner faces of the annuli 14, 15 forming the walls C<SP>1</SP>, C<SP>2</SP>. Alternatively, in addition to, or in place of the recesses 16 the baffles have pressed radial or circumferential ribs, or both. The barrel A may have longitudinal ribs and be in sections, and is enclosed in a ribbed or corrugated, sheet metal, outer casing M. The junctions of the portions 11 of the baffles and the rings 12 form pockets for the sound-deadening material, so that when the silencer is disposed vertically and tendency of the material to settle clear of the upper sets of bosses 17 is virtually eliminated by the compensating volume of the material which gravitates from the pockets. Similar arrangements may be made in the walls C<SP>1</SP>, C<SP>2</SP> by providing curved portions 18 in the annuli 14, 15.
